8. Margus Hunt (defensive end) – The good news for Hunt is that he was a 2nd round draft pick in 2013. The bad news is that he hasn’t shown enough production on the field to justify keeping him around – certainly not long-term. In 4 years, Hunt has tallied 29 tackles and only 1.5 sacks. Granted, the Cincinnati Bengals thought of him as a project pick when they took him. But eventually, projects must pay off – and Hunt hasn’t done much when given the chance aside from using his 6’8″ frame to block some extra points. Don’t expect to see more than a 1-year deal. In fact, with 11 draft picks in 2017 for the Bengals, 1 year seems too generous to us. Re-sign (yep or nope): Nope
9. Wallace Gilberry (defensive end) – Gilberry has been a solid contributor as a rotational backup on the defensive line (20.5 sacks over the last 5 years). What’s better, he can play both end and tackle. That kind of versatility is great when you want to get maximum production from a 53-man roster. He’s liked and respected on the team and in the community. At 32 years old, he may not have a whole lot of gas left in the tank, but he’s an NFL veteran who has proven himself … which is why we say give him another year. Re-sign (yep or nope): Yep
